From f09f860b12da8f0a33134c17900da7e4d890f18e Mon Sep 17 00:00:00 2001 From: Pavel Chupin Date: Mon, 14 Apr 2014 18:38:39 +0400 Subject: [PATCH] Add libstdc++ symbols for 64-bit archs Done by ndk/build/tools/gen-system-symbols.sh script Change-Id: I6804e059468f755e18212df43a05a8ec7c3d5a79 Signed-off-by: Pavel Chupin --- .../symbols/libstdc++.so.functions.txt | 23 +++++++++++++++++++ .../symbols/libstdc++.so.variables.txt | 2 ++ .../symbols/libstdc++.so.functions.txt | 23 +++++++++++++++++++ .../symbols/libstdc++.so.variables.txt | 3 +++ .../symbols/libstdc++.so.functions.txt | 23 +++++++++++++++++++ .../symbols/libstdc++.so.variables.txt | 2 ++ 6 files changed, 76 insertions(+) create mode 100644 ndk/platforms/android-20/arch-arm64/symbols/libstdc++.so.functions.txt create mode 100644 ndk/platforms/android-20/arch-arm64/symbols/libstdc++.so.variables.txt create mode 100644 ndk/platforms/android-20/arch-mips64/symbols/libstdc++.so.functions.txt create mode 100644 ndk/platforms/android-20/arch-mips64/symbols/libstdc++.so.variables.txt create mode 100644 ndk/platforms/android-20/arch-x86_64/symbols/libstdc++.so.functions.txt create mode 100644 ndk/platforms/android-20/arch-x86_64/symbols/libstdc++.so.variables.txt diff --git a/ndk/platforms/android-20/arch-arm64/symbols/libstdc++.so.functions.txt b/ndk/platforms/android-20/arch-arm64/symbols/libstdc++.so.functions.txt new file mode 100644 index 000000000..991ae87ca --- /dev/null +++ b/ndk/platforms/android-20/arch-arm64/symbols/libstdc++.so.functions.txt @@ -0,0 +1,23 @@ +_ZN9type_infoC1ERKS_ +_ZN9type_infoC1Ev +_ZN9type_infoC2ERKS_ +_ZN9type_infoC2Ev +_ZN9type_infoD0Ev +_ZN9type_infoD1Ev +_ZN9type_infoD2Ev +_ZNK9type_info4nameEv +_ZNK9type_info6beforeERKS_ +_ZNK9type_infoeqERKS_ +_ZNK9type_infoneERKS_ +_ZdaPv +_ZdaPvRKSt9nothrow_t +_ZdlPv +_ZdlPvRKSt9nothrow_t +_Znam +_ZnamRKSt9nothrow_t +_Znwm +_ZnwmRKSt9nothrow_t +__cxa_guard_abort +__cxa_guard_acquire +__cxa_guard_release +__cxa_pure_virtual diff --git a/ndk/platforms/android-20/arch-arm64/symbols/libstdc++.so.variables.txt b/ndk/platforms/android-20/arch-arm64/symbols/libstdc++.so.variables.txt new file mode 100644 index 000000000..d5aab6670 --- /dev/null +++ b/ndk/platforms/android-20/arch-arm64/symbols/libstdc++.so.variables.txt @@ -0,0 +1,2 @@ +_ZSt7nothrow +_ZTV9type_info diff --git a/ndk/platforms/android-20/arch-mips64/symbols/libstdc++.so.functions.txt b/ndk/platforms/android-20/arch-mips64/symbols/libstdc++.so.functions.txt new file mode 100644 index 000000000..991ae87ca --- /dev/null +++ b/ndk/platforms/android-20/arch-mips64/symbols/libstdc++.so.functions.txt @@ -0,0 +1,23 @@ +_ZN9type_infoC1ERKS_ +_ZN9type_infoC1Ev +_ZN9type_infoC2ERKS_ +_ZN9type_infoC2Ev +_ZN9type_infoD0Ev +_ZN9type_infoD1Ev +_ZN9type_infoD2Ev +_ZNK9type_info4nameEv +_ZNK9type_info6beforeERKS_ +_ZNK9type_infoeqERKS_ +_ZNK9type_infoneERKS_ +_ZdaPv +_ZdaPvRKSt9nothrow_t +_ZdlPv +_ZdlPvRKSt9nothrow_t +_Znam +_ZnamRKSt9nothrow_t +_Znwm +_ZnwmRKSt9nothrow_t +__cxa_guard_abort +__cxa_guard_acquire +__cxa_guard_release +__cxa_pure_virtual diff --git a/ndk/platforms/android-20/arch-mips64/symbols/libstdc++.so.variables.txt b/ndk/platforms/android-20/arch-mips64/symbols/libstdc++.so.variables.txt new file mode 100644 index 000000000..1fc475d91 --- /dev/null +++ b/ndk/platforms/android-20/arch-mips64/symbols/libstdc++.so.variables.txt @@ -0,0 +1,3 @@ +_GLOBAL_OFFSET_TABLE_ +_ZSt7nothrow +_ZTV9type_info diff --git a/ndk/platforms/android-20/arch-x86_64/symbols/libstdc++.so.functions.txt b/ndk/platforms/android-20/arch-x86_64/symbols/libstdc++.so.functions.txt new file mode 100644 index 000000000..991ae87ca --- /dev/null +++ b/ndk/platforms/android-20/arch-x86_64/symbols/libstdc++.so.functions.txt @@ -0,0 +1,23 @@ +_ZN9type_infoC1ERKS_ +_ZN9type_infoC1Ev +_ZN9type_infoC2ERKS_ +_ZN9type_infoC2Ev +_ZN9type_infoD0Ev +_ZN9type_infoD1Ev +_ZN9type_infoD2Ev +_ZNK9type_info4nameEv +_ZNK9type_info6beforeERKS_ +_ZNK9type_infoeqERKS_ +_ZNK9type_infoneERKS_ +_ZdaPv +_ZdaPvRKSt9nothrow_t +_ZdlPv +_ZdlPvRKSt9nothrow_t +_Znam +_ZnamRKSt9nothrow_t +_Znwm +_ZnwmRKSt9nothrow_t +__cxa_guard_abort +__cxa_guard_acquire +__cxa_guard_release +__cxa_pure_virtual diff --git a/ndk/platforms/android-20/arch-x86_64/symbols/libstdc++.so.variables.txt b/ndk/platforms/android-20/arch-x86_64/symbols/libstdc++.so.variables.txt new file mode 100644 index 000000000..d5aab6670 --- /dev/null +++ b/ndk/platforms/android-20/arch-x86_64/symbols/libstdc++.so.variables.txt @@ -0,0 +1,2 @@ +_ZSt7nothrow +_ZTV9type_info